What is Amazon Prime Day and Why Should You Care
Amazon Prime Day is a two-day sales event held once a year, typically in July. It showcases thousands of deals across a multitude of categories, from electronics to household items, making it one of the most anticipated shopping events for online consumers. The discounts often rival those found during Black Friday or Cyber Monday.
By participating in Amazon Prime Day, you can save significantly on items you may have been eyeing for a while. 6. Tips for Maximizing Your Savings on Amazon Prime Day
Want to ensure you get the absolute best deals this Prime Day? Here are some savvy tips to maximize your savings:
- Set a Budget: Before you dive in, determine how much you’re willing to spend. This will keep you focused and help avoid impulse buys.
- Create a Wish List: Browse and compile a wish list of items you truly want. This allows you to quickly check for deals without getting sidetracked.
- Use Price Trackers: Utilize tools like CamelCamelCamel to monitor price trends on Amazon. This will help you identify whether a deal is genuinely a bargain.
- Check Lightning Deals: Keep an eye out for “lightning deals” that are time-sensitive and can save you hefty amounts, often up to 80%!
- Combine Offers: Look for bundled offers or discounts on your favorite products. Sometimes you can stack savings, maximizing your budget!

2. How do I know if Prime Day deals are worth it?
To gauge whether a deal is a good one, compare the sale price to the regular price. Check historical pricing on websites like CamelCamelCamel or use Amazon’s price tracking features. Also, read reviews on products to ensure you’re getting the most value!
3. Can I access Prime Day deals without a membership?
Unfortunately, Prime Day promotions are exclusive to Amazon Prime members. If you’re not a member yet, you can sign up for a free trial during Prime Day to take advantage of the deals. Just remember to cancel if you don’t wish to continue afterward.
